Billboard Hot 100 into AOL Music and Yahoo!

Firman Firdaus — August 13, 2007 / 1:29 am / 2 comments

THE world’s most comprehensive music resource, Billboard, has released its legendary Hot 100 into digital format. Billboard announced an expansion of its Hot 100 formula to include weekly streamed and on-demand music data to the chart’s traditional mix of sales and radio airplay.
